Address Resolution Protocol

Address Resolution Protocol (ARP) is a telecommunications protocol used for resolution of network layer addresses into link layer addresses, a critical function in multiple-access networks. ARP was defined by RFC 826 in 1982. It is Internet Standard STD 37. It is also the name of the program for manipulating these addresses in most operating systems.

ARP has been implemented in many combinations of network and overlaying internetwork technologies, such as IPv4, Chaosnet, DECnet and Xerox PARC Universal Packet (PUP) using IEEE 802 standards, FDDI, X.25, Frame Relay and Asynchronous Transfer Mode (ATM), IPv4 over IEEE 802.3 and IEEE 802.11 being the most common cases.

In Internet Protocol Version 6 (IPv6) networks, the functionality of ARP is provided by the Neighbor Discovery Protocol (NDP).

Internet protocols
Application layer
  • DHCP
  • DHCPv6
  • DNS
  • FTP
  • HTTP
  • IMAP
  • IRC
  • LDAP
  • MGCP
  • NNTP
  • NTP
  • POP
  • RPC
  • RTP
  • RTSP
  • SIP
  • SMTP
  • SNMP
  • SOCKS
  • SSH
  • Telnet
  • TLS/SSL
  • XMPP
  • (more)
Transport layer
  • TCP
  • UDP
  • DCCP
  • SCTP
  • RSVP
  • (more)
Routing protocols *
  • BGP
  • OSPF
  • RIP
  • (more)
Internet layer
  • IP
    • IPv4
    • IPv6
  • ICMP
  • ICMPv6
  • ECN
  • IGMP
  • IPsec
  • (more)
Link layer
  • ARP/InARP
  • NDP
  • Tunnels
    • L2TP
  • PPP
  • Media access control
    • Ethernet
    • DSL
    • ISDN
    • FDDI
  • (more)
* Not a layer. A routing protocol belongs either to application or network layer.

Read more about Address Resolution Protocol:  Operating Scope, Packet Structure, Example, ARP Probe, ARP Announcements, ARP Mediation, Inverse ARP and Reverse ARP, ARP Spoofing and Proxy ARP, Alternatives To ARP, ARP Stuffing

Famous quotes containing the words address and/or resolution:

    I believe the alphabet is no longer considered an essential piece of equipment for traveling through life. In my day it was the keystone to knowledge. You learned the alphabet as you learned to count to ten, as you learned “Now I lay me” and the Lord’s Prayer and your father’s and mother’s name and address and telephone number, all in case you were lost.
    Eudora Welty (b. 1909)

    A great many will find fault in the resolution that the negro shall be free and equal, because our equal not every human being can be; but free every human being has a right to be. He can only be equal in his rights.
    Mrs. Chalkstone, U.S. suffragist. As quoted in History of Woman Suffrage, vol. 2, ch. 16, by Elizabeth Cady Stanton, Susan B. Anthony, and Matilda Joslyn Gage (1882)